Amendments to CFTC Rules of Practice and Rules Relating to Investigations

The Commodity Futures Trading Commission ("CFTC" or "Commission") is amending its Rules of Practice and its Rules Relating to Investigations. The revised Rules of Practice enhance the transparency of the Commission's enforcement proceedings, specifying that the Commission can accept an offer of settlement by order of the Commission and establishing requirements for the form and content of recommendation memos provided by the Division of Enforcement to the Commission when recommending an offer of settlement. The revised Rules Relating to Investigations revise the applicable procedures when the Division of Enforcement notifies persons who may be named in an enforcement action, including that the notification or confirmation of the notice be in writing.
